Some dating software is still "undefended" for minors.

  Multiple social apps can still be used normally without "real-name authentication". Insiders suggest that the youth mode should be turned on by default.

  Recently, many netizens found and reported that some dating software is not strict with the use of minors. The Beijing Youth Daily reporter found that when using multiple strangers’ dating software, there is no need for real-name authentication, and minors can use these strangers’ social software "unimpeded". It is particularly noteworthy that in terms of function, there is no difference between unauthenticated accounts and other accounts, and accounts without real-name authentication can also purchase adult products at will. In this regard, many people in the industry have suggested that the youth mode can be turned on by default when the user does not log in with an ID card.

  Multiple social App users can also be rewarded without real-name authentication.

  The reporter of Beiqing Daily recently found that many social apps, such as soul, Detective, Momo, etc., can be used normally by simply choosing to log in with WeChat or mobile phone number without "real-name authentication".

  These platforms all suggest that users must be over 18 years old when registering. For example, after soul registers, users need to choose the date of birth, but users can enter the interface without hindrance by filling in a date over 18 years old at will. Among them, soul needs to use a virtual avatar, and exploration and Momo need to add a real and clear avatar.

  In the process of use, the above App will send a pop-up window in teenager mode to the user. The reporter of Beiqing Daily noticed that the youth mode entering Soul needs real-name authentication, and people’s faces will be dynamically recognized during the authentication process. After the tester enters his real name information, he can’t enter the teenager mode again. The teenage mode of exploring and momo is to set the password directly.

  In view of the fact that it can be used normally without real-name authentication, Momo customer service responded: "Some functions need real-name use." When asked which functions will be affected by not having a real name, the customer service did not give a positive answer. In addition, regarding whether the real name will restrict consumption, the customer service said: "No real name will not restrict consumption."

  When using the live reward function of Detective and Momo, even the account without real-name authentication will automatically jump to WeChat or Alipay.

  In terms of recharge, none of the above three softwares has relevant restrictions or secondary verification for minors. And there is no real name account and unlimited consumption, which can recharge the highest amount of soul coins, exploration coins, momo coins and VIP recharge.

  Push content is undifferentiated, making friends and shopping are not affected.

  The reporter of Beiqing Daily used an account without real-name authentication on a dating software, and marked "the second day" in the introduction. After searching for keywords such as "making friends in junior high school", "sexy underwear" and "adult products" on the home page, a lot of related push content appeared. The purchase of goods can automatically jump to WeChat or Alipay. In other words, if minors are not authenticated in this platform, it will not affect their use.

  After several keyword searches, Beiqing Daily reporter used the test account to open the above-mentioned dating software again, and the homepage push also became the corresponding content related to keywords, in which minor dating also appeared directly and many times. In the shopping column, most of the products pushed also meet the previous keywords.

  In the actual measurement, the reporter of Beiqing Daily also found that there are multiple video platforms in the youth protection mode, and the platforms will impose restrictions on young users in terms of content, usage duration and consumption.

  For example, the daily use time should not exceed 40 minutes, and it is forbidden to use the software from the evening to the next morning, and it is impossible to open or watch the live broadcast, reward, recharge, cash withdrawal and so on. For example, a survey shows that in the youth mode, except for the functions of mobile phone recharge and city service, other functions of life service, transportation and shopping consumption are all disabled, while the functions of financial management are directly hidden. Aauto Quicker and Tik Tok, short video applications, banned teenagers from watching live broadcasts, which fundamentally prevented the risk of teenagers’ recharge and reward. Tik Tok also closed Tik Tok Mall. Video platforms Iqiyi, Tencent, Youku and Mango TV have closed the membership center and all other consumption channels such as financial welfare and games. Bilibili has also closed consumer operations such as membership purchase and top-up rewards.

  Directly open the youth mode for the unauthenticated netizen platform.

  In response to the measured results of the reporter of Beiqing Daily, Professor Shang Jianhui, deputy dean of the School of Journalism and Communication of Hebei University, believes that the platform practice that has not yet imposed restrictions on young users does not conform to the norms. "According to the explicit requirements of the Regulations on the Protection of Minors’ Network (Draft for Comment) and the Regulations on the Protection of Children’s Personal Information Network, the network platform should formulate special rules and user agreements for the protection of children’s personal information. Therefore, this practice of the platform should be improved, otherwise it may cause harm such as premature maturity of children and deception of the network. "

  Professor Shang suggested how to improve the platform’s protection measures for minors. "At present, there are some voices in academic circles. The index system of minors’ network protection includes 19 indicators in six dimensions, including information prompt, technical protection, anti-addiction (comprehensive) management, emergency complaint and reporting mechanism, privacy and personal information protection system, scientific popularization and publicity and education."

  "Technical protection, information tips, scientific popularization and publicity and education are the weak links in the protection of minors on the Internet platform. The platform should first strengthen technical security protection and realize standardized management of the platform; Secondly, construct an omni-directional information prompt matrix to optimize the use environment of minors; Furthermore, practice the concept of multi-knowledge inclusiveness and do a good job in popular science and publicity and education; Finally, improve the youth model and enrich the content pool for minors. " Professor Shang said.

  Some operators who did not want to be named told the reporter of Beiqing Daily that "registering with a mobile phone number does not mean real-name authentication. Operators will not synchronize all users’ personal information to all platforms at will. It is not excluded that operators cooperate with some larger platforms to authorize the platforms to identify information through mobile phone numbers, but only if both parties sign an agreement to ensure the other party’s safe storage and standardized use of personal information. Therefore, it cannot be said that registering with a real-name mobile phone number is equivalent to real-name authentication. "

  Earlier, Jiang Yaodong, member of Chinese People’s Political Consultative Conference and former vice president of China University of Mining and Technology (Beijing), also suggested that "for users who have not been authenticated, the platform can default the user to enter the youth mode, which can protect minors from browsing age-appropriate content to the greatest extent."

  According to public data, in 2021, the number of underage netizens in China reached 191 million, and the Internet penetration rate of minors reached 96.8%. According to a survey released by Beijing Internet Court, from June 2022 to May 2023, Beijing Internet Court accepted a total of 143 civil disputes involving minors, and the number of cases increased year by year, with game recharge and live rewards accounting for the largest proportion. Among them, the phenomenon that minors involved in litigation evade family supervision and anti-addiction measures is more prominent, and most minors evade family supervision and platform authentication measures. At the same time, minors are easily influenced by bad information. Some minors use the Internet to browse pornographic, bloody and violent bad content, and some minors are influenced by the online war and the "network water army" and learn to imitate bad online behavior.
